The metric scale system is based on the decimal system, where measurements are expressed in units of 10. The system consists of seven base units: meter (length), gram (mass), liter (volume), kelvin (temperature), ampere (electric current), mole (amount of substance), and second (time). These base units are then used to derive derived units, such as force, pressure, and energy. The metric scale system also employs prefixes, such as kilo- (thousand), mega- (million), and milli- (thousandth), to express measurements in various scales.

    The increasing globalization of trade, commerce, and technology has created a demand for a standardized measurement system. The US, being a melting pot of cultures and industries, has seen a growing need for a consistent and universal language of measurement. The metric scale system, with its decimal-based structure, offers a clear and efficient way to communicate measurements, making it an attractive option for businesses, scientists, and educators. As the US continues to engage with international partners, understanding the metric scale system has become a crucial aspect of doing business, conducting research, and educating the next generation.
